Which Texas cities do we cover?

Which Texas cities do we cover?

We work with businesses across the state, from Houston and San Antonio to Dallas, Austin, Fort Worth, El Paso, and the fast-growing North Texas suburbs.

Treating Texas as a single audience is the most common and most expensive mistake in statewide marketing. The metros differ in cost, competition, and in how people search.

Cost per click in Dallas and Austin runs well above San Antonio or El Paso for the same category, which means the same budget buys very different results depending on where it is pointed. We set expectations per market rather than averaging them into one misleading number.

If you serve several cities, we would usually rather win one properly first and use what it teaches to enter the next, than spread a budget thin enough that none of them move.

  • Houston and the Gulf Coast, including Corpus Christi
  • Dallas, Fort Worth, and the North Texas suburbs from Plano to McKinney
  • Austin and Central Texas
  • San Antonio and South Texas, including Laredo
  • El Paso and West Texas, including Lubbock

When is demand highest for dentists?

When is demand highest for dentists?

Late summer brings family appointments before the school year.

Year-end produces a reliable surge as patients use remaining insurance benefits before they reset.

Patient lifetime value is high, which justifies a considerably higher acquisition cost than a single appointment suggests.

We plan spend around this rhythm rather than spreading it evenly, because visibility built ahead of a peak costs less than visibility bought during one.

How is Video Editing success measured and reported?

The measures below are the ones we hold ourselves to. Impressions and follower counts are not among them.

Platforms measure whether people keep watching and distribute accordingly, so retention is the metric the edit serves.

The reporting line that matters for dentists is cost per the new patient appointment. Everything else on the dashboard is diagnostic, not a result.

You will get the bad months as clearly as the good ones, because a report you cannot trust is worth nothing.

  • Cost per view where the video is being amplified
  • Retention curve, and specifically where viewers drop
  • Watch-through rate on short form
  • Click-through from video to site or inquiry
